Output 23d8d63b2d2e85e54fdd81981d56fe2191bfe0c0e5c297c8dc62df43ba3d282b:0

value
260887691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b555721dfe9fb25bb4f7b741cd750b777fb6b3d9 OP_EQUAL
address
3JDpb99RhVAXDu6w4YxZRSsUdDe537yY45
transaction
23d8d63b2d2e85e54fdd81981d56fe2191bfe0c0e5c297c8dc62df43ba3d282b
confirmations
268692
spent
true